A polygon has an area of 144 square inches and one of its sides is 17 inches long. If a second similar polygon has an area of 64 square inches, what is the length of the corresponding side in the second polygon?

OpenStudy (becca9898):

A. 10 3/8 B. 11 1/3 C. 15 3/5 D. 25 1/2

OpenStudy (faiqraees):

Area of first shape/length of first shape^2 = Area of second shape/length of second shape^2

OpenStudy (becca9898):

@FaiqRaees so 144/17^2 = 64/x^2 ??

OpenStudy (faiqraees):

yep

OpenStudy (becca9898):

then x would equal 34 / 3 ?

OpenStudy (becca9898):

Ok! So the answer would be B! Thank you @FaiqRaees !!!
